NIAGARA SHARE CORPORATION OF MARYLAND v. FRIED

No. 448.

61 F.2d 740 (1932)

NIAGARA SHARE CORPORATION OF MARYLAND v. FRIED et al.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Second Circuit.

September 12, 1932.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Curtin & Glynn, of New York City (John J. Curtin and Wesley S. Sawyer, both of New York City, of counsel), for appellant Fried.

Kenefick, Cooke, Mitchell, Bass & Letchworth, of Buffalo, N. Y., and Porter R. Chandler, of New York City (Lyman M. Bass and Fritz Fernow, both of Buffalo, N. Y., of counsel), for appellee.

Before MANTON, SWAN, and AUGUSTUS N. HAND, Circuit Judges.


AUGUSTUS N. HAND, Circuit Judge (after stating the facts as above).

The question raised by this appeal is whether the complainant, Niagara Share Corporation of Maryland, transferee of all the assets of Niagara Share Corporation of Delaware, can enforce a contract made by the defendants with the latter corporation that certain specified securities purchased by it from Lincoln Interstate Holding Company should realize at least the sum of $1,074,000.
